Great. Fantastic. Could you tell us a little bit more about how volumes have been trending recently?

Katherine Stueland
President and CEO, GeneDx

Absolutely. As we took a look at Q1, about 17% of our volume was in exome, and that represented, on the revenue side, more than 50% of our revenues. The conversion to exome is critically important. We have seen, in Q2, that 17% tick up to about 20% so far. We're starting to really see the conversion, and the execution of our sales team really nicely translate into volumes as well as revenues. That really is what accounts for the type of sustainable growth that I mentioned we're focused on. Really being able to continue to convert existing customers to exome, bring in new customers outside of the genetics experts.

Think, pediatric neurologists, and neurologists, pediatric cardiologists, bring them in and get them starting to utilize our testing, which may be by using something like chromosomal microarray, or CMA. That is a test that commonly is used before, a shift to exome. We took a look actually at some of our customers and what we've been able to see over the past three months, and we've seen our sales strategy working. We're seeing in customers who have been historically ordering CMA, their use of exome is increasing month-over-month, March, April, May, and CMA numbers are coming down. That tells us that ultimately our sales team is very effective in that switch, which is a data-driven approach.

It's important not only for our business in terms of our ability to sustainably grow, in a high-growth era, but also it's better for patient care. We've been able to utilize some of the data that we've presented that shows that use of exome is actually delivering a higher diagnostic yield with fewer variants of uncertain significance. It's not only good for our business, but most importantly, it's better patient care for those who are utilizing our testing.

Great. Speaking of clinical trials, could you tell us more about the SeqFirst and GUARDIAN studies and any updates there?

Katherine Stueland
President and CEO, GeneDx

Certainly. SeqFirst is a study that we embarked on with the University of Washington looking in the inpatient setting as well as the outpatient setting for exome and genome. What we've been able to do with that study is drive, I would say, in particular in the outpatient study, quite a bit of engagement with patients there. That really sets the standard for why exome and genome in that setting first. What are the health economic benefits of it? We have some data that shows that in the inpatient setting, we're able to help save $30,000 per patient by utilizing an exome or genome in that setting. In the outpatient setting, about $6,800 per patient.

That study is really looking to further establish the importance of exome and genome upfront. The GUARDIAN study, which is with Wendy Chung, looking at newborn screening for healthy infants. We're looking at 250 conditions. We kicked off enrollment last fall. In October, we had rapid enrollment. This spring, we had about 1,500 patients or families who signed up for it. About 75% of those families who we offered it to agreed to be in the study, which I think is remarkable in terms of the willingness of parents to really start to utilize the technology. What we found, and Dr. Chung presented at ACMG about this, we identified in 2.6% of patients, a pathogenic finding.

We also did a retrospective analysis, taking a look at our database of more than 450,000 exomes, looking at those 250 conditions to say: "Okay, historically, how many... At what age were we able to diagnose these patients?" Historically, in 20% of patients, it was age seven, eight, nine, 10, 11. We're now able to diagnose them at birth. When you think about the ability to do that rapidly, it also correlates with the average time to diagnosis for a rare disease, which tends to be about eight years. We're able to provide information that puts the provider in a place of being able to intervene when necessary.

Ultimately, we're hoping to be able to really either prevent disease, but at a minimum, be able to slow down the progression of disease. When we heard that data, particularly the 2.6% and then the retrospective analysis, that's a game changer. That's a game changer. I think interestingly, there's a lot of really good work that has been going on over the past 15 years in this space. There's been good dialogue and discussion about the ethics of how do you do this in the right way. Dr. Robert Green out of Harvard has done a lot of work on BabySeq. What information are you providing to parents, at what point in time?

All of that is being explored, and I would say we've seen a really positive shift, thanks to data like this coming out of GUARDIAN, that shows that the entire genetics community is starting to move down a place of newborn screening is something that we should be doing. It's just a matter of: How are we providing that information? At what point in time? What does the consent look like by way of the parents consenting to this information? Who's paying for it? We're starting to move to, I would say, an era where we see this as a fortunate inevitability, and we're very pleased to be leading the dialogue and investment in this space as well.

Great. We have the pleasure of being joined by your CFO, Kevin Feeley, here, and so maybe one for him, if you want to chime in on, how you're thinking about gross margins going forward, especially as it relates to the mix shift as you start doing more exomes, compared to panels?

Kevin Feeley
CFO, GeneDx

Yeah, I think it's an important question, and it's anchored on that conversion strategy that Katherine outlined to move from legacy-targeted tests and gene panels, which have a less favorable gross margin profile versus our exome product. The exome product today is at 60% gross margin. We know we've got room to take down COGS on that product. We know that there'll be evolution in reimbursement coverage to the positive that should allow for average reimbursement rates to continue to climb. Really view that exome gross margin of 60% as a baseline in which we can expand from. Total company gross margins are less than that and really are a function of that test mix dynamic that we see. In the Q1 , 17% of all tests were exome.

We've now seen in the Q2 that reach about a 20% benchmark, and we expect to expand that meaningfully over the coming months. That should allow for total company gross margins to expand. You couple in cost efficiencies, insurance reimbursement improvements to raise reimbursement rates, and a focus on a portfolio approach. We're looking hard at what is the strategic value of each of the test offerings that we have on our test menu, which is expansive, and ultimately driving towards a one test platform anchored on exome and genome.

Okay. Hot topic in the space these days. With the emergence of new sequencing technologies, competitive platforms to Illumina, maybe some changes going on now at Illumina, how could that benefit you from lowering costs of sequencing and potential for new platforms to further lower COGS?

Kevin Feeley
CFO, GeneDx

Yeah, I think... Look, ultimately, competition we view as a positive thing for everybody. About a third of all costs for us are inputs, with a third coming from production steps within the four walls of our laboratory, and about a third being that back-end analysis and interpretation platform. That's really where GeneDx has proven differentiation, not only in the breadth and knowledge of that analysis platform, which Katherine spoke about, but that's where we've been able to drive down costs in the most meaningful way over the past half decade, and we'll continue to do so. Our laboratory processes are built to be agnostic towards the sequence manufacturer.

Ultimately, we've got great partnerships with both companies that you've mentioned, and are actively collaborating with both of them on how do we expand access, lower costs, so that we can expand access to more and more patients to get this, what we view as life-saving, life-changing technology.

Great. could we maybe talk more about your physician education efforts and how you're helping docs to better understand the benefits of exome?

Katherine Stueland
President and CEO, GeneDx

Absolutely. The growth that we've seen across all of our testing is really attributed to the commercial investment that we've been able to make on the education side of things, as well as a strengthening approach to our medical affairs team as well. We're very pleased. GeneDx has always been at the forefront of gene and disease discovery, the correlation between. As we learn more about variants and their role in disease, we've published, I think, more than 350 publications over the past decade or so. It is all a data-driven approach. We're generating not only clinical data, but health economics data. Our sales team is out there partnering with a medical science liaison.

We're having meaningful conversations with thought leaders in the space. Importantly, I think we're working collaboratively, not only with Illumina, PacBio, on overall, I would say, awareness of the importance of genome-based healthcare, but also working more collaboratively with payers on it. As we've gotten to really entrench ourselves in the health economics data and the view of commercial payers in particular, there's a clear benefit to being able to really skip a lot of the utilization of panels and go right to exome. We published data in autism, looking at, I think it was 19,000 patients. In 90% of the time, when patients did have a prior genetic test before exome, 90% of the time, it was a negative test.

With exome, we were able to deliver a positive. That is, I think, really emblematic of the shift that we're trying to make. It is, not only taking more time to diagnose these patients, it's derailing diagnosis to patients. It's racking up significant costs to the healthcare system, and, there's a lot of work going into the emotional and psychosocial costs of not having a diagnosis for eight years. I think that all of that is really important. We're also doing a lot of work on a state-by-state perspective as it comes down to Medicaid opening up, access. We're pleased that there have been, I think, 28 states that are covering, exome and genome in the outpatient setting.

We had a team member joined by thought leaders in Massachusetts, because there's a bill being introduced there that opens up access to rapid whole genome sequencing in the state. We have a very, I would say, data-driven approach to it, but we have deployed an army of really passionate advocates for opening up access across the board.
